5 more die of Covid-19 in Haryana, 679 new cases

As many as 19,369 people have been infected with Covid-19 in Haryana. On Thursday, 679 fresh cases were reported in the state, while the death toll toll stood at 287.

Gujarat's Surat records highest one-day spike of 307 Covid cases

Surat district in Gujarat recorded its highest one-day spike of 307 coronavirus cases, taking the infection tally to 7,581, while death toll went up by six to 277, state health department said.

Bengal registers more than 1000 new Covid-19 cases

Bengal on Thursday registered 1,088 fresh Covid-19 cases. This is the highest single day spike registered in the state till date. The state also registered its highest death toll in 24 hours. As many as 27 people died of the infection in the state on Thursday.

Covid-19 pandemic in Africa is now reaching ‘full speed’

The coronavirus pandemic in Africa is reaching “full speed” and it’s good to prepare for the worst-case scenario, the Africa Centers for Disease Control and Prevention chief said Thursday, after a South African official said a single province is preparing 1.5 million graves.

1,248 new Covid-19 cases reported in UP

As many as 1,248 fresh cases of coronavirus were reported in UP on Wednesday. State Principal Secretary (Health) Mohan Prasad said, "In the last 24 hours, 1,248 new COVID-19 positive cases have been reported in the state. There are 10,373 active cases, 21,127 discharged so far and 862 patients have succumbed to the infection."
